摘要:
      目的:探讨雷公藤甲素对羊膜复合异体神经移植促神经再生和功能恢复的作用。方法:成年SD雄性大鼠30只,随机分3组,切除10mm坐骨神经造模,造模后3组分别采用自体神经移植、异体神经移植加雷公藤药物、异体神经移植。移植术后第24周,观察移植段神经形态学、坐骨神经指数(SFI,术后第8周开始)、胫前肌湿重、单位面积移植神经中段轴突数量和髓鞘厚度。结果:移植术后第24周自体神经移植组和异体神经移植加雷公藤药物组的坐骨神经指数、单位面积移植神经中段轴突数量和髓鞘厚度、胫前肌湿重各项检测指标无显著差异(P>0.05), 但再生神经形态和功能恢复良好,检测的各项指标明显优于异体神经移植组(P<0.05)。结论:雷公藤甲素可促进同种异体神经移植神经再生和功能恢复治疗坐骨神经损伤。

The use of triptolide in sciatic nerve deficit bridged by amnion allograft    Download Fulltext

Abstract:
      Objective:To investigate the effect of triptolide on nerve regeneration and function recovery in the allogenic nerve graft bridged by amnion. Method: The sciatic nerve deficit model was performed by excising 10mm of the nerve. Thirty adult male SD rats were randomly divided into autologous nerve graft group, experimental group (allogenic nerve graft bridged by amnion and triptolide) and allogeneic nerve graft group,10 mice in each group. Twenty-four weeks after transplantation, the morphological changes,sciatic nerve function index(SFI),wet weight of bilateral tibialis anterior muscle,the number of transplanted nerve axons in unit area and the thickness of the myelin nerve axons were observed. Result: The recovery on morphology and function of regenerative nerve in autologous nerve graft group and experimental group were better than those in allogeneic nerve graft group. Among three groups there were significant differences of SFI, wet weight of bilateral tibialis anterior muscle, the number of transplanted nerve axons in unit area and the thickness of the myelin nerve axons(P<0.05). Conclusion: Triptolide can promote nerve regeneration and function recovery in the allogenic nerve graft bridged by amnion to treat sciatic nerve deficit.
